Abstract

With the new development of electricity reform, many problems that involving the release of retail side need to be solved, which makes the compliance risk management very crucial. Compliance risk management is a kind of management theory that can proactively identify and manage the compliance risks that may exist, and propose preventive measures based on the compliance program, this theory can improve the market mechanism effectively. This paper analyzed the problems of compliance risk management in electricity market from three aspects, and proposed some solutions to enhance the management.
